Requirements

Be 18 years or over before the start date. Have the right to live and work in Wales (if you are on a visa, this needs to enable you to legally work and reside in Wales for the entire duration of the programme). Have lived in the UK or in the European Economic Area (EEA) for the last 3 years. Be a resident of Wales for the entire duration of the programme. Not be registered to study on a UK government funded course ending August 2026 or later. Have a minimum of 5 GCSEs (or equivalent) at grades 4 or above (C or above) including Maths and English. You must NOT already have a qualification in a similar subject at the same or higher level than this apprenticeship.

Training & development

Blended and Work-based Learning including on-the-job training, digital learning and mentoring from IT team members. Virtual classroom/virtual based training to cover knowledge, on-the-job training, online learning, and mentoring from IT team members.
